What is Yuvomi?
Yuvomi is a self-hosted family organizer that brings all household management into a private space : tasks, shopping lists, meals and recipes, calendar, budget, cleaning, documents, notes, contacts, and birthdays. Each feature is a module that can be enabled as needed, with no cloud account or subscription.
Technically, Yuvomi runs as a single container (Docker or Podman, including Podman rootless on RHEL/Fedora/CentOS) with an Express.js backend that serves both the API and the interface. Data is stored in an SQLite database that can be encrypted with AES-256 via SQLCipher, and the application performs no telemetry.
